Every bonus comes with wagering requirements – the amount you must bet before you can cash out any winnings derived from the bonus. For example, a 30x wagering on a AUD 100 bonus means you need to place bets totalling AUD 3 000 before withdrawal. It’s essential to read the fine print so you’re not surprised by restrictions on certain games or maximum bet limits during the wagering period.

Responsible gambling tools are built into the account dashboard. You can set deposit limits, session timers and loss caps, or even self‑exclude for a defined period. The platform also links to Australian responsible gambling organisations, offering counselling resources and self‑assessment tests.
If you ever feel that gambling is affecting your wellbeing, use the “Self‑Exclusion” feature to temporarily block access. The process is quick: navigate to the responsible gambling tab, select the desired exclusion period, and confirm. Your account will be locked for the chosen duration, and you’ll receive a confirmation email.
